What Is Pediatric Dentistry?

Pediatric dentistry is the branch of dentistry that focuses on the oral health of children from infancy through the teen years. Since children’s teeth and gums are still developing, they require special care and attention to ensure proper growth and development. Why Children Need Special Dental Care

Children’s dental care differs from adult care in several ways. Children’s teeth, gums, and jaws are still growing, and the care they receive during these formative years plays a key role in preventing future oral health issues. Here are a few reasons why children need special dental care:

  • Growth and Development: Children’s mouths are growing and developing, making their dental care needs different from adults.
  • Cavity-Prone Teeth: Kids’ teeth are more susceptible to cavities, especially during their early years.
  • Behavioral Differences: Children may feel nervous or scared about visiting the dentist, which requires a gentle and compassionate approach.
  • Preventative Care: Early dental visits help catch potential problems like tooth decay, misaligned teeth, and gum issues early on, preventing bigger problems later.

Common Dental Problems in Children

It’s common for children to experience dental issues as they grow. Some of the most common dental problems that children face include:

1. Tooth Decay (Cavities)

Tooth decay is the most prevalent dental issue in children. Poor oral hygiene, sugary snacks, and drinks can cause cavities, leading to discomfort and infections if untreated.

2. Early Childhood Caries (ECC)

Also known as baby bottle tooth decay, this condition affects infants and toddlers who often have prolonged exposure to sugary liquids like milk, juice, or formula, leading to rapid tooth decay.

3. Thumb Sucking Effects

Prolonged thumb sucking can cause issues such as misaligned teeth, bite problems, and changes in the shape of the roof of the mouth.

4. Misaligned Teeth

Teeth that are crooked, crowded, or misaligned can affect the appearance of your child’s smile and may cause issues with biting and chewing.

5. Gum Problems

Gum diseases such as gingivitis can affect children, especially if they neglect oral hygiene. Swollen or bleeding gums may indicate an issue that needs professional attention.

1. Dental Check-ups

Regular dental check-ups are essential for identifying and preventing issues early on. Dr. Gullapalli will evaluate your child’s teeth, gums, and overall oral health during these visits and provide advice on how to care for their teeth.

2. Fluoride Treatment

Fluoride is a safe and effective way to strengthen your child’s teeth and prevent cavities. Fluoride treatment helps to protect teeth from decay by making them more resistant to acid attacks from plaque and sugars.

3. Dental Sealants

Dental sealants are a thin, protective coating applied to the chewing surfaces of the back teeth to prevent cavities from forming. This treatment is quick, painless, and highly effective in preventing tooth decay.

4. Tooth-Colored Fillings

If your child develops cavities, we use tooth-colored fillings to restore the teeth. These fillings blend in seamlessly with the natural color of the teeth, ensuring a more aesthetic outcome.

5. Pulpectomy / Root Canal for Kids

In some cases, children may need a pulpectomy (a type of root canal treatment) to treat an infected or severely decayed tooth. We use specialized techniques to make this procedure as comfortable as possible for your child.

6. Space Maintainers

If your child loses a baby tooth early, we may use space maintainers to hold the space open for the permanent tooth to come in properly. This helps to prevent misalignment and ensures proper dental development.

7. Habit-Breaking Appliances

If your child engages in thumb sucking or other habits that may affect their oral development, we can provide habit-breaking appliances to help them stop these habits and prevent long-term dental issues.

When Should a Child First Visit the Dentist?

The American Academy of Pediatric Dentistry recommends that children should visit the dentist for the first time by age 1 or within six months of their first tooth eruption. Early visits help identify any issues before they become bigger problems and allow us to build a positive relationship with your child, making future visits easier.

Tips for Parents to Maintain Kids’ Oral Health

Preventing dental issues in children starts with good habits at home. Here are some helpful tips for parents:

  • Brush Teeth Twice a Day: Help your child brush their teeth twice a day with fluoride toothpaste. Make it a fun activity to ensure they enjoy the process.
  • Limit Sugary Snacks and Drinks: Reduce your child’s intake of sugary foods and drinks to prevent cavities. Encourage healthier snacks like fruits and vegetables.
  • Floss Daily: As soon as your child has two teeth that touch, begin flossing them daily.
  • Regular Dental Visits: Schedule routine dental check-ups to catch potential issues early on and keep your child’s teeth and gums healthy.
  • Avoid Prolonged Bottle Use: Don’t allow your child to fall asleep with a bottle of milk or juice. This can lead to early childhood caries.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. At what age should my child first visit the dentist?

The first visit should be by age 1 or within six months of the first tooth eruption.

2. Are dental X-rays safe for children?

Yes, dental X-rays are safe for children and are performed with the lowest radiation dose necessary.

3. How can I prevent cavities in my child?

Encourage regular brushing, limit sugary snacks, and schedule regular dental check-ups.

4. What if my child is afraid of the dentist?

We take a gentle, child-friendly approach to help ease their anxiety and ensure a positive dental experience.

5. How much does kids’ dental treatment cost in Hyderabad?

The cost varies based on the treatment. Basic check-ups are more affordable, while more complex treatments like root canals may cost more.

6. Are baby teeth really important?

Yes, baby teeth are essential for speech, chewing, and guiding permanent teeth into place.

7. What is fluoride treatment for kids?

Fluoride treatments strengthen the enamel and help prevent cavities, especially in young children.
